Kuenne's attempts to arrange interviews with the prosecutors and judges who facilitated Turner's freedom were denied, but, in 2006, a panel convened by Newfoundland's Ministry of Justice released a report stating that Zachary's death had been preventable and the government's handling of Turner's case had been inadequate. Dear Zachary: A Letter to a Son About His Father is a 2008 American documentary film written, produced, directed, edited, and scored by Kurt Kuenne.
